Honest Review of the Remington 783 in .308 Win
I recently had the opportunity to spend some time with the Remington 783 chambered in .308 Win, and I wanted to share my thoughts on this rifle. First and foremost, the build quality of the Remington 783 is impressive for its price point. The synthetic stock is sturdy and provides a good grip, which is vital for maintaining control during shooting. The overall design feels solid and durable, making it a suitable option for both new and experienced shooters. One of the standout features of the Remington 783 is its AccuTrigger system. This adjustable trigger allows for a smooth pull, which is essential for accurate shooting. I found that I could easily customize the trigger weight to my preference, leading to improved performance on the range. The accuracy of this rifle is commendable; I was able to achieve tight groupings at various distances, which speaks to its reliability in the field. The .308 Win caliber is a great choice for versatility. It can handle everything from target shooting to big game hunting, making the Remington 783 a practical option for a variety of shooting scenarios. The recoil was manageable, especially with appropriate ammunition, which made shooting it a pleasant experience. On the downside, the rifle is somewhat on the heavier side compared to other models in its class, which might be a consideration for those looking to carry it over long distances while hunting. Additionally, while the stock is functional, it lacks some of the aesthetic appeal found in higher-end models. Overall, I would recommend the Remington 783 in .308 Win to anyone looking for an affordable, reliable, and accurate rifle. It’s a solid choice for both beginners and seasoned shooters who appreciate a good value.
